Creamy Custard Pie for Elegant Holiday Celebrations

A rich and creamy custard baked in a flaky pie crust, perfect for festive occasions.

  • Total Time: 1 hour 5 minutes
  • Yield: 8 slices

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 prepared pie crust
  • 4 large eggs
  • 2 cups whole milk
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ground nutmeg
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Place the pie crust in a pie dish and set aside.
  2. In a mixing bowl, whisk eggs, sugar, vanilla, nutmeg, and salt until well combined.
  3. Heat milk until just steaming, then slowly whisk into the egg mixture.
  4. Pour the custard filling into the pie crust.
  5. Bake for 45-50 minutes until set and lightly golden on top. Cool before serving.

Notes

  • For a richer flavor, substitute half of the milk with heavy cream.
  • Serve with a dollop of whipped cream or a dusting of nutmeg for garnish.
